A furnace produces a stack gas that has an analysis of 8.93% CO2, 1.56% CO, 0.34% SO2, 9.87% O2 and the rest N2. The coal burnt contains 1.7% N, 15% ash, and 5.5% S. While the refuse contains uncoked coal with 20.71% HV lost.
Calculate:
(a) Complete ultimate analysis of coal;
(b) Complete analysis of the refuse if it contains 37.93% ash;
(c) % excess air. Establish basis as 100 kg of coal.
